How to Avoid Online Payment Fraud While Using UPI Apps, E-Wallets?

The Frauds that happen with the UPI apps and E-wallet are impacting the rural population a lot. People in rural areas are not that educated and unknowingly share the details of payment to others leading to a big fraud and loss of money. This not only is affecting rural areas but also has affected their counterparts in urban areas in India. Many Fraudsters send payment request to rural people in order to steal money and get succeeded. The growing online transaction habit in India is making it hard to avoid the fraud caused due to UPI apps and E-wallets. According to the data provided by National Payments corporation of India almost 2.29 billion number of transactions have been done using UPI in India. The more the number of payments take place using UPI, the more is the chance to increase the Fraud due to it. The Scammers are doing this to find number of ways to steal the money earned by individuals using the UPI and E-wallets. Many of the victims of such scam can be seen posting daily on social media about it.

The list of victims not only include the rural populations but also the urban population is becoming a victim of this scam. Recently Harshita Kejriwal, daughter of Delhi CM Arvind Kejriwal, was victimized to scam on selling a sofa worth Rs 34000. Social engineering can be found in various forms and we can call it as smishing and phishing. The UPI always asks for pin when one accepts the payment and the moment the pin is put which is the last step to transaction, the fraudsters are liable of making a fraud transaction towards your bank account. This is how the scam takes place and one get victimized for the online payment fraud. Various offline and online campaigns to inform their customers about frauds taking place through UPI apps and e-wallets by most of the top commercial banks. The NPCI has also shared few guidelines to avoid such frauds through their social media handles.
